How much do part time estes express line haul j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 30,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time estes express line haul in Butler, GA is $32.42,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$22.74 and $40.34 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Part Time Estes Express Line Haul vs Part Time Estes Express Local Driver?

AspectPart Time Estes Express Line HaulPart Time Estes Express Local Driver
CredentialsCommercial Driver's License (CDL)CDL
Work EnvironmentLong-distance, highway routesShort-distance, local deliveries
Employer & Industry UsageFreight transportation, logisticsSame industry, different routes
Search & Comparison IntentLong-haul freight jobsLocal delivery roles

Part Time Estes Express Line Haul involves long-distance freight transportation requiring CDL certification and typically involves highway routes. In contrast, Part Time Estes Express Local Driver focuses on short-distance deliveries within local areas. Both roles are essential in the logistics industry but differ mainly in route length and work environment.

Job Summary
This position can be scheduled to work in several areas in the SRC such as Front Desk, Cardio Deck, Weight Room or Rec Express.
All areas must provide customer service to patrons using the Student Recreation Center. The Information Desk Staff is a source for information concerning events and locations with the Student Recreation Center as well as elsewhere on campus. It is important that Information Desk Staff knows the answers to questions or can find the answers to questions when asked. The Information Desk Staff is expected to help enforce building policies and provide security for the facility in terms of what items are brought into and removed from the building
This position will also supervise and Monitor the Cardio and Weight Rooms and adjacent workout spaces ie basketball court, and movement rooms located in the Student Recreation Center. This position will maintain inventory at the Rec Express and check out equipment to patrons.
